BOK Financial Corporation Group includes BOKF, NA; BOK Financial Securities, Inc. and BOK Financial Private Wealth, Inc. BOKF, NA operates TransFund and Cavanal Hill Investment Management, Inc. BOKF, NA operates banking divisions: Bank of Albuquerque; Bank of Oklahoma; Bank of Texas and BOK Financial.

Job Description

The Technical Analyst II is responsible for delivering superior services acting as a liaison between the line of business and IT with a focus on end user experience such as user interfacing, user flow, data flow, and/or other UI/UX strategies. Defining and performing analysis, design, programming, planning, implementation, and supporting moderate to complex systems software and procedures with a focus on our long term technology road map which require technical and systems knowledge. Manages plans, organizes, and controls projects which have an organizational impact as well as provides day-to-day support for complex applications systems.

Team Culture

Ourmission is toempower our company, teammates andcustomers through thedelivery of resilient andcustomer-centric technology. We achieve this by leveraging our expertise in technology and deepunderstandingofour business units.

How You'll Spend Your Time
  • You will write business requirements and document customer needs and expectations for simple projects.
  • You will analyze, design, plan, test, and deploy simple to complex systems software and programs. This includes researching and defining problem functions involving existing systems and programs, developing input and output requirements and recommending appropriate design to meet those requirements.
  • You will provide business process modeling and project estimates for simple projects and system enhancements.
  • You will provide day-to-day support for the operation of complex application systems developing complex test plans and scenarios and designing and conducting program and integrated system tests.
  • You will train user personnel on new or modified systems by preparing training materials and conducting training one-on-one or in a classroom setting.
  • You will design, document and provide reports through the use of report writers or through coordination with service providers.
  • You will have general technical understanding of single application data flows across multiple applications, software and system integrations, RDBMA principles, tiered environments, Cloud environments, and project management skills.
